English idioms related to Feelings
doom and gloom
[عبارت]

a feeling or attitude that makes one believe that things can only get worse after a certain point

بدبینی یا ناامیدی

بدبینی یا ناامیدی

Ex: While acknowledging the challenges, it's important not to succumb to a constant state of doom and gloom, but instead seek solutions and hope for a better future.

out of whack
[عبارت]

used to describe a person who is feeling mentally disturbed or unbalanced

به‌هم‌ریخته

به‌هم‌ریخته

Ex: Losing his job was tough on Mike and he acknowledges out of whack for a few months after .

down in the mouth
[عبارت]

feeling sad or discouraged

افسرده و غمگین

افسرده و غمگین

Ex: Despite the cheerful surroundings , she down in the mouth and could n't shake her sadness .

kick in the teeth
[عبارت]

something that proves to be very shocking and disappointing to one, in a way that ruins one's good mood

ضد حال

ضد حال

Ex: Receiving a rejection letter from her dream college was a crushing kick in the teeth, dashing her hopes and forcing her to reconsider her plans.

black mood
[عبارت]

a period of time during which one feels extremely miserable and depressed

دوره افسردگی

دوره افسردگی

Ex: As the team faced a string of losses, the locker room was filled with black moods, as players grappled with disappointment and frustration.

long face
[اسم]

a disappointed or sad facial expression

پَکر

پَکر

Ex: When I told her we had to cancel our plans , she could n't hide her long face, clearly disappointed by the sudden change of events .وقتی به او گفتم که باید برنامه‌هایمان را لغو کنیم، نتوانست **چهره طولانی** خود را پنهان کند، که به وضوح از تغییر ناگهانی رویدادها ناامید شده بود.

out of sorts
[عبارت]

irritated, upset, or slightly unwell

بی‌دل‌ودماغ, بدخلق

بی‌دل‌ودماغ, بدخلق

Ex: The sudden change in routine threw the toddler out of sorts, resulting in tantrums and a general sense of unease throughout the day.
